Call for Papers

We are delighted to invite short paper submissions for our Symposium entitled The Process and Implications of Doing Social Theory.  The event will provide a platform for early career scholars to discuss papers as part of themed workshops, receive feedback from distinguished discussants and peers, engage in constructive dialogue, and meet other social theorists from across a wide range of social theoretical disciplinary fields.

The Symposium will include two elements:

Papers will be grouped into thematic workshops (based on overlapping areas of interest) where each paper will be allocated a 25-minute slot for collective discussions. Each paper will be allocated a discussant from among four distinguished scholars and all other workshop attendees will be encouraged to read the papers in advance in order to contribute to a wider discussion and offer constructive feedback. These insights will, we hope, contribute to informing and refining your work for future publication.
A roundtable event where the four guest discussants will share reflections from their own theoretical work (the processes by which they undertake social theoretical scholarship, highlighting the methods they employ to generate original concepts and insightful interventions), followed by a wider discussion where we will consider further aspects of the conditions of producing social theoretical work.
We encourage the submission of short papers embedded within social theory and a wide range of sub-fields such as (but not limited to): political sociology, elites, nationalism, and international migration; disability, independent living, international social policy, (post)socialism and social justice; political ethnography, social and political change, time and the future; Black Atlantic political thought, cultural studies, and feminist and Marxist theory.
